| 1 | Case of pediatric traditional serrated adenoma resected via endoscopic submucosal dissection显示文摘Traditional serrated adenoma(TSA)is a type of serrated polyp of the colorectum and is thought to be a precancerous lesion.There are three types of serrated polyps,namely,hyperplastic polyps,sessile serrated adenomas/polyps,and TSAs.TSA is the least common of the three types and accounts for about 5% of serrated polyps.Here we report a pediatric case of TSA that was successfully resected by endoscopic submucosal dissection(ESD).This rare case report describes a pediatric patient with no family history of colonic polyp who was admitted to our hospital with hematochezia.On colonoscopy,we found a polypoid lesion measuring 10 mm in diameter in the lower rectum.We selected ESD as a surgical option for en bloc resection,and histopathological examination revealed TSA.The findings in this case suggest that TSA with precancerous potential can occur in children,and that ESD is useful for treating this lesion. | Sonoko Kondo Hirohito Mori Noriko Nishiyama Takeo Kondo Ryuichi Shimono Hitoshi Okada Takashi Kusaka | 2017 | World Journal of Gastroenterology2017,23,24: | 4 |

| 5 | The KDM4B–CCAR1–MED1 axis is a critical regulator of osteoclast differentiation and bone homeostasis显示文摘Bone undergoes a constant and continuous remodeling process that is tightly regulated by the coordinated and sequential actions of bone-resorbing osteoclasts and bone-forming osteoblasts.Recent studies have shown that histone demethylases are implicated in osteoblastogenesis;however,little is known about the role of histone demethylases in osteoclast formation.Here,we identified KDM4B as an epigenetic regulator of osteoclast differentiation.Knockdown of KDM4B significantly blocked the formation of tartrate-resistant acid phosphatase-positive multinucleated cells.Mice with myeloid-specific conditional knockout of KDM4B showed an osteopetrotic phenotype due to osteoclast deficiency.Biochemical analysis revealed that KDM4B physically and functionally associates with CCAR1 and MED1 in a complex.Using genome-wide chromatin immunoprecipitation(ChIP)-sequencing,we revealed that the KDM4B–CCAR1–MED1 complex is localized to the promoters of several osteoclast-related genes upon receptor activator of NF-κB ligand stimulation.We demonstrated that the KDM4B–CCAR1–MED1 signaling axis induces changes in chromatin structure(euchromatinization)near the promoters of osteoclast-related genes through H3K9 demethylation,leading to NF-κB p65 recruitment via a direct interaction between KDM4B and p65.Finally,small molecule inhibition of KDM4B activity impeded bone loss in an ovariectomized mouse model.Taken together,our findings establish KDM4B as a critical regulator of osteoclastogenesis,providing a potential therapeutic target for osteoporosis. | Sun-Ju Yi You-Jee Jang Hye-Jung Kim Kyubin Lee Hyerim Lee Yeojin Kim Junil Kim Seon Young Hwang Jin Sook Song Hitoshi Okada Jae-Il Park Kyuho Kang Kyunghwan Kim | 2021 | Bone Research2021,9,3: | 1 |
| 6 | BCR–ABL-specific CD4^(+) T-helper cells promote the priming of antigen-specific cytotoxic T cells via dendritic cells显示文摘The advent of tyrosine kinase inhibitor(TKI)therapy markedly improved the outcome of patients with chronic-phase chronic myeloid leukemia(CML).However,the poor prognosis of patients with advanced-phase CML and the lifelong dependency on TKIs are remaining challenges;therefore,an effective therapeutic has been sought.The BCR–ABL p210 fusion protein’s junction region represents a leukemia-specific neoantigen and is thus an attractive target for antigen-specific T-cell immunotherapy.BCR–ABL p210 fusion-region-specific CD4+T-helper(Th)cells possess antileukemic potential,but their function remains unclear.In this study,we established a BCR–ABL p210 b3a2 fusion-region-specific CD4+Th-cell clone(b3a2-specific Th clone)and examined its dendritic cell(DC)-mediated antileukemic potential.The b3a2-specific Th clone recognized the b3a2 peptide in the context of HLA-DRB1*09:01 and exhibited a Th1 profile.Activation of this clone through T-cell antigen receptor stimulation triggered DC maturation,as indicated by upregulated production of CD86 and IL-12p70 by DCs,which depended on CD40 ligation by CD40L expressed on b3a2-specific Th cells.Moreover,in the presence of HLA-A*24:02-restricted Wilms tumor 1(WT1)235–243 peptide,DCs conditioned by b3a2-specific Th cells efficiently stimulated the primary expansion of WTI-specific cytotoxic T lymphocytes(CTLs).The expanded CTLs were cytotoxic toward WT1235–243-peptide-loaded HLA-A*24:02-positive cell lines and exerted a potent antileukemic effect in vivo.However,the b3a2-specific Th-clone-mediated antileukemic CTL responses were strongly inhibited by both TKIs and interferon-α.Our findings indicate a crucial role of b3a2-specific Th cells in leukemia antigen-specific CTL-mediated immunity and provide an experimental basis for establishing novel CML immunotherapies. | Norihiro Ueda Rong Zhang Minako Tatsumi Tian-YiLiu Shuichi Kitayama YutakaYasui Shiori Sugai Tatsuaki Iwama Satoru Senju Seiji Okada Tetsuya Nakatsura Kiyotaka Kuzushima Hitoshi Kiyoi Tomoki Naoe Shin Kaneko Yasushi Uemura | 2018 | Cellular & Molecular Immunology2018,15,1: | 1 |

| 17 | Operation and Consideration of a Pipe Corrosion Inspection System Based on Human-in-the-Loop Machine Learning显示文摘The aim of this study is to improve the efficiency of external corrosion inspection of pipes in chemical plants.Currently,the preferred method involves manual inspection of images of corroded pipes;however,this places significant workload on human experts owing to the large number of required images.Furthermore,visual assessment of corrosion levels is prone to subjective errors.To address these issues,we developed an AI(artificial intelligence)-based corrosion-diagnosis system(AI corrosion-diagnosis system)and implemented it in a factory.The proposed system architecture was based on HITL(human-in-the-loop)ML(machine learning)[1].To overcome the difficulty of developing a highly accurate ML model during the PoC(proof-of-concept)stage,the system relies on cooperation between humans and the ML model,utilizing human expertise during operation.For instance,if the accuracy of the ML model was initially 60%during the development stage,a cooperative approach would be adopted during the operational stage,with humans supplementing the remaining 40%accuracy.The implemented system’s ML model achieved a recall rate of approximately 70%.The system’s implementation not only contributed to the efficiency of operations by supporting diagnosis through the ML model but also facilitated the transition to systematic data management,resulting in an overall workload reduction of approximately 50%.The operation based on HITL was demonstrated to be a crucial element for achieving efficient system operation through the collaboration of humans and ML models,even when the initial accuracy of the ML model was low.Future efforts will focus on improving the detection of corrosion at elevated locations by considering using video cameras to capture pipe images.The goal is to reduce the workload for inspectors and enhance the quality of inspections by identifying corrosion locations using ML models. | Toshihiro Shimbo Yousuke Okada Hitoshi Matsubara | 2023 | Journal of Mechanics Engineering and Automation2023,13,5: | 0 |
| 18 | Hayabusa2’s station-keeping operation in the proximity of the asteroid Ryugu显示文摘The Japanese interplanetary probe Hayabusa2 was launched on December 3,2014 and the probe arrived at the vicinity of asteroid 162173 Ryugu on June 27,2018.During its 1.4 years of asteroid proximity phase,the probe successfully accomplished numbers of record-breaking achievements including two touchdowns and one artificial cratering experiment,which are highly expected to have secured surface and subsurface samples from the asteroid inside its sample container for the first time in history.The Hayabusa2 spacecraft was designed not to orbit but to hover above the asteroid along the sub Earth line.This orbital and geometrical configuration allows the spacecraft to utilize its high-gain antennas for telecommunication with the ground station on Earth while pointing its scientific observation and navigation sensors at the asteroid.This paper focuses on the regular station-keeping operation of Hayabusa2,which is called“home position”(HP)-keeping operation.First,together with the spacecraft design,an operation scheme called HP navigation(HPNAV),which includes a daily trajectory control and scientific observations as regular activities,is introduced.Following the description on the guidance,navigation,and control design as well as the framework of optical and radiometric navigation,the results of the HP-keeping operation including trajectory estimation and delta-V planning during the entire asteroid proximity phase are summarized and evaluated as a first report.Consequently,this paper states that the HP.keeping operation in the framework of HPNAV had succeeded without critical incidents,and the number of trajectory control delta-V was planned fficiently throughout the period. | Yuto Takei Takanao Saiki Yukio Yamamoto Yuya Mimasu Hiroshi Takeuchi Hitoshi Ikeda Naoko Ogawa Fuyuto Terui Go Ono Kent Yoshikawa Tadateru Takahashi Hirotaka Sawada Chikako Hirose Shota Kikuchi Atsushi Fuji Takahiro Iwata Satoru Nakazawa Masahiko Hayakawa Ryudo Tsukizaki Satoshi Tanaka Masanori Matsushita Osamu Mori Daiki Koda Takanobu Shimada Masanobu Ozaki Masanao Abe Satoshi Hosoda Tatsuaki Okada Hajime Yano Takaaki Kato Seiji Yasuda Kota Matsushima Tetsuya Masuda Makoto Yoshikawa Yuichi Tsuda | 2020 | Astrodynamics2020,4,4: | 0 |
